Skincare Empties
Glow Recipe Plum Plump Hyaluronic Acid Hydrating Serum
Price: $38 for 1oz
The GR Plum Plump serum is a hyaluronic serum that aims to hydrate and plump the skin. The serum of course contains hyaluronic acid, but it also contains plum (antioxidant), along with Vegan Collagen and Silk Proteins (skin barrier protection). Compared to other hyaluronic serums that I’ve tried in the past, this one differed as it included different weights of hyaluronic acid. What I mean by this they vary from ultra-low, low, medium, high, and ultra-high molecular weight.
The serum lives up to its claim of being hydrating and helps to plump the skin. I do think the formula penetrated deeper in comparison to other hyaluronic serums that I’ve tried in the past. While using the serum in my routine my skin felt more hydrated and softer to the touch. I do think $38 for a hyaluronic serum is on the pricey side, but I did notice a difference while using it.
Skin 1004 Madagascar Centella Hyalu-Cica Cloudy Mist
Price: $20 for 4oz
I picked this one up on a whim during a Marshall’s visit. I was really interested in the mist as it’s being marketed as a fine face mist that’s aimed for hydration and soothing. The Cloudy Mist is infused with Hyalu-Cica, green tea water, and ceramides. Based on the description I thought the mist was going to be super hydrating and soothing on the skin. But I really don’t think the mist did anything. It almost felt like I was applying plain water to my face.
I would apply the mist, and my skin would soak it up and after it dried it only slightly (I mean the teeniest amount) feel more hydrated. Based on these results, or should I say lack thereof, I don’t think I would purchase this again.
Prequel PreGleanse Cleansing Oil
Price: $20 for 6.5oz
What an interesting name for a cleanser. What is a PreGleanse? According to Prequel the PreGleanse is a cleansing oil, which are known for being used as the first step in your evening routine. The cleansing oil works to break down the first layer of impurities of your skin including sunscreen, makeup, and other impurities on the skin. I really appreciate that this cleanser has a pump packaging, which it made it easier to dispense.
As for the formula, the cleanser is made with cica oil, linoleic acid, rice bran oil along with Vitamin E and Vitamin F. This blend helps to cleanse the skin without stripping it. I feel like this was one of the lightest consistency oils that I ever tried! I really like the feel of the oil and I think it worked well to quickly breakdown my makeup. I really enjoyed using this cleanser and I think the price point matches the performance of the product.
Youth to the People - Superfruit Gentle Exfoliating Cleanser with Vitamin C + Papaya
Price: $39 for 5oz
The YTTP Superfruit Gentle Cleansing that is formulated with fruit enzymes and actives that helps to brighten and boost the overall look of the skin. The brightening ingredients include Vitamin Cg, Yerba Mate, Ginger Root, and Papaya. As for the actives that are included, its formulated with Salicylic, Glycolic, Lactic, and Phytic Acids. I used cleanser from the summer months into the winter months and it worked well for my skin.
During the summer months my skin was fine with using the cleanser a couple times a week. But as the months became cooler, I moved to using it about once a week because my skin wasn’t producing as much oil. I feel like my skin, which is normal to oily skin that’s dehydrated, tolerated the cleanser well during the summer months, but during the winter months I could really feel the drying effects on my skin. With that being said, if you have dry skin this will likely make your skin feel drier after using it - especially it during the cooler months. I can say I didn’t have any issues with the cleanser causing any reactions or my skin feeling sensitive.
Body Care Empties
Beekman 1802 KISSES Candy Cane Whipped Body Cream
Price: $14 for 2oz (mini size)
The Candy Cane scent is a limited edition scent from the Beekman x Hershey’s collab and it smells so good! As with the majority of the Beekman products, this too is formulated with Goat Milk along with Mango Seed butter, and Vitamin E. I really enjoyed using this cream in my routine. The whipped body cream has an ultra light consistency and quickly absorbed into the skin. Most would assume that a lighter consistency would mean a lighter level of moisture, but I can’t say that theory applies to this body cream. The Whipped Body Cream deeply moisturized my skin and the moisture lasted all day long making it perfect for the fall and winter months. I didn’t find the scent to be overwhelming and I felt it actually layered really nice with many of my fragrances.
Scent Notes:
Top: Sweet Peppermint, White Cocoa Powder
Middle: Milk Chocolate Kiss, Melted Butter
Bottom: Caramelized Sugar, Vanilla Bean

Hanni Waterbalm Instant Hydration Body Moisturizer Mist
Price: $37 for 6.76oz
The Waterbalm is a weightless mist that is said to hydrate the skin without leaving a residue behind. I love the idea of spray on moisturizer, especially on days when I’m rushing or when I don’t want to do a full on routine of applying a body cream. I really enjoyed this waterbalm in terms of hydration and moisture during the summer months. The lightweight consistency was perfect for the summer days when only a light layer level of moisture is needed. During the fall and winter months, I felt like this didn’t provide enough moisture though, unless I applied a body cream over it as an additional layer.
Even though I didn’t find this to be the most moisturizing, I really loved the waterbalm mist for the scent!! The scent encompasses notes of rose stems, pink pepper, palmarose, geranium, and warm amber. I often reached for the waterbalm for the scent more than anything else!
Sol de Janeiro Bom Dia Bright Body Cream
Price: $48 for 8oz
The Bom Dia scent from Sol de Janeiro ties to their Cheirosa Perfume Mist. The scent has notes of Black Amber Plum, Jasmine Woods, and Vanilla Woods.
The Bom Dia Body Cream is formulated with Salicylic Acid, AHA/Glycolic Acid, and Vitamin C. The combination aims to gently exfoliate the skin along with smoothing and brightening the skin. The moisturizer itself has a nice level of moisturizer. I more so reached for the Bom Dia for the scent. I really love the scent on it’s own, but I also enjoyed using it as a base layer to layer fragrances on top of it.

Kerastase Mini Nutritive 8H Magic Night Serum Hydrating Treatment for Dry Hair
Price: $32 for 1oz
I used my Sephora points to redeem and apparently this 1 oz size is also sold as a mini! Being that I was able redeem points, I thought this was a great time to try out this serum. The 8hr serum magic night serum serves as a leave-in that is formulated with plant based proteins and niacinamide. The combination aids to nourish the hair, help retain moisture, and lock in hydration.
I really enjoyed using this serum on damp hair prior to blow drying. I think it made a difference with locking in moisture and making my hair feel softer; thus helping with frizz. I would also use the serum on dry hair as instructed focusing on the ends and mid-shaft of the hair and I can’t really say I’ve noticed a difference using it like this. Since emptying this tube I’ve purchased another mini, so I’ll be sure to report back after I’ve had more time to use the product. For now I’m on the fence.

Peter Thomas Roth 24k Gold Mask
Price: $85 for 5 oz
This very well be one of the prettiest masks from the PTR collection, but how effective is it?! The 24 Gold Mask is made with actual 24k gold, Colloidal Gold, Magnesium, and Caffeine. The combination is formulated to lift, firm, and brighten the skin. Being that the mask doesn't contain any harsh actives I was able to use it at ease. While using the mask I can’t say I noticed much of a difference in terms of brightening effects, but I can say I liked the way my skin felt after removing the mask. It felt moisturized and toned. I can’t say the effects are worth purchasing this at the retail price. Since finishing this mask, I actually purchased a mini size since it came in a kit that I wanted that was super discounted.

Mala the Brand Candle – Mint Cocoa
Price: $58 for the 3 pack | $19.33 per candle 4.3oz
I’ve gone through several of the Mala Brand Candles and my review of them has remains the same. I get some that burn well and some that don’t. I really love that their candles have a wood wick. The crackling sound of the wood burning really adds to the burning experience of the candles. As for the mint cocoa scent, the candle smelled really nice. I found that scent throw was very light on this - even with burning it in a smaller space. Previously Reviewed: February ‘24 Empties
Scent notes: mint cocoa | chocolate + peppermint + vanilla * exclusive!
